i had the same database issue using JBoss 4.0.2 as well as with 
version [whatever the latest version of was with the latest CVS checkout on May 
8]. 

The simple solution pointed out by zaphod68 seemed to work for me, namely
to change:


  <depends>jboss:service=Hypersonic,database=localDB</depends>
  | 
to 


<depends>jboss:service=Hypersonic</depends>

No other changes, and it went just as the documentation said it would.
